Located in Walcha, Walcha Royal Accommodation is within a 5-minute drive of Walcha Pioneer Cottage Museum and Langford Homestead. This upscale guesthouse is 11.4 mi (18.3 km) from Oxley Wild Rivers National Par ... Read more

View all Luxury Hotels in Walcha (NSW)